Descripción del trabajo
At ReCodme, we accelerate the technological development of our clients and collaborators through specialized solutions, delivering value to ensure their continuity and growth.
We believe in staying close to our people and recognizing the added value they bring to our team and projects. A ReCoder is a tech enthusiast—(the key to our success), the key to our strength!
We are looking for a skilled Full-Stack Developer with expertise in Kotlin and Angular to join our team. The ideal candidate will have a strong background in both backend and frontend development, experience working with cloud environments, and a passion for building scalable and high-performance applications.
What do you need to be part of this project?
Responsibilities:
- Develop and maintain front-end and back-end applications using Angular and Spring Boot.
- Implement user interface designs using HTML, CSS, JavaScript, and TypeScript.
- Optimize application performance and scalability on the server side.
- Work with databases such as PostgreSQL (JDBC), MongoDB, and manage migrations using Flyway.
- Design and implement RESTful APIs to support frontend applications.
- Conduct unit and end-to-end testing using JUnit, Vitest/Jest, and Playwright.
- Deploy and manage applications in Azure using Docker, Terraform, and Azure DevOps.
- Collaborate with designers, frontend and backend developers to ensure high-quality and user-friendly interfaces.
- Lead and mentor team members, promoting best coding practices and software architecture.
Requirements:
- 5+ years of experience with Kotlin, TypeScript/JavaScript, and CSS.
- 5+ years of experience working with Spring Boot and Angular.
- Experience with build tools like Vite and Gradle.
- Strong knowledge of RESTful APIs and their implementation.
- Experience with containerization and cloud deployment (Docker, Azure, Azure DevOps, Terraform).
- Familiarity with OpenLayers and TurfJS for geographic applications.
- Strong problem-solving skills and ability to work in Agile environments.
Nice to Have:
- Experience with NodeJS, NestJS, Strapi.
- Understanding of basic linear algebra and geometry (university-level).
Languages:
Work Mode:
Are you ready to embrace this force? Submit your application!
At ReCodme, we advocate for equality and value diversity. We create a safe, diverse environment where opportunities are equal for all collaborators.
We do not discriminate based on age, ethnicity, sexual orientation, gender, disability, or any other factor unrelated to merit.
All applications meeting the required skills for the position are welcome!